birthday |
the day on which a person was born, usually celebrated each year on that date. |
carton |
a box made of heavy paper. |
coach |
a person who trains and teaches people in sports. |
court |
a place where legal matters are heard. |
crooked |
bent, curved, or twisting. |
fin |
a thin, flat body part of a fish and certain other water animals which is used for swimming or balance. |
hungry |
feeling a need or want for food. |
hunter |
a person who tries to find and kill animals for food. |
neat |
clean and in proper order, or liking to keep things that way. |
parent |
a mother or a father. |
pay |
to give money to (a person or business) in exchange for things or services. |
praise |
to speak well of. |
speaker |
a person who uses words to say things. |
strong |
having power; difficult to break or damage. |
suppose |
to assume to be true in order to make clear or to explain. |
